Given the value of Rydberg constant is 10^(7) m^(-1) the wave number of the last line of the Balmer series in hydrogen spectrum will be

Answer»

`0.5xx10^(7)m^(-1)`
`0.25xx10^(7)m^(-1)`
`2.5xx10^(7)m^(-1)`
`0.025xx10^(7)m^(-1)`

Solution :For Balmer series
`(1)/(LAMBDA)=R[(1)/(2^(2))-(1)/(OO^(2))]` For final line` n=oo`
`(1)/(lambda)=(R)/(4)=(10^(7))/(4)`
`:.(1)/(lambda)=0.25xx10^(7)m^(-1)`
`:.` Wave number `0.25xx10^(7)m^(-1)`
